RN - On-Demand Clinic - Behavioral Health Focus - Tulsa

Muscogee Creek Nation Department of Health
  • Tulsa, Oklahoma
    26 days ago

    Job Description

    M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S

    Education – Graduate of an accredited School of Nursing (AND or BSN). Bachelor of Science in Nursing (BSN) preferred.

    Experience – Minimum of three (3) to five (5) years of clinical nursing experience. Experience in outpatient behavioral health, psychiatric triage, or crisis intervention, preferred. Prior experience delivering nursing triage or care via telehealth/virtual platforms preferred. Demonstrated experience using electronic health records (Epic preferred).

    Licenses & Certification – Current State of Oklahoma license as a Registered Nurse (RN), or ability to obtain prior to employment. Basic Life Support (BLS) required.

    Knowledge & Skills –

    1. Knowledge of ambulatory care, triage protocols, and virtual care delivery modes.

    2. Strong clinical judgment in mental health conditions, substance use disorders, and psychiatric emergencies.

    3. Knowledge of telehealth-specific privacy laws and regulations (e.g., HIPPA).

    4. Ability to coordinate care across disciplines and work within a team-based virtual environment.

    5. Proficient written and verbal communication skills.

    6. Ability to navigate sensitive patient interactions via video/phone using empathy and de-escalation techniques.

    7. Proficiency in multitasking between virtual documentation and active patient engagement.

    JOB SUMMARY

    The Registered Nurse (RN)-On-Demand Clinic provides timely, high-quality, patient-centered care exclusively through a telehealth model, with a specific focus on addressing behavioral health needs and acute medical concerns. This role is designed to deliver episodic care and behavioral health interventions via virtual encounters, serving as a primary remote access point for patients in need of care coordination, assessment, and short-term management. Care delivery and documentation are performed in accordance with MCNDOH policies and procedures, applicable State and Federal regulations, and accepted standards of practice for virtual medicine.

    WORK ENVIRONMENT

    Work is performed remotely within a dedicated virtual health environment. Frequent interaction with patients occurs via video and/or telephone platforms. The provider may encounter patients who are distressed, acutely ill, or experiencing behavioral health crisis while navigating the limitation of a remote setting.

    PHYSICAL DEMANDS

    Prolonged computer use, including video visits and typing for extended periods. 

    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S

    On-Demand Clinical Care (Telehealth)

    1. Virtual Triage: Conduct virtual triage and clinical assessments for on-demand behavioral health patients.

    2. Crisis Management: Utilize de-escalation techniques and coordinate emergency services for patients in acute crisis.

    3. Provider Support: Assist Advanced Practice Providers (APPs) with care coordination, order entry, and patient follow-ups.

    4. System Support: Bridge primary care and behavioral health departments, working together.

    5. Care Coordination: Coordinate care to outpatient care, therapy services, or community mental health resources.

    6. Documentation: Maintain accurate, timely electronic health records in compliance with clinic protocols.

          Quality, Safety, and Administrative Duties

      1. Participates in quality improvement initiatives related to telehealth efficiency, behavioral health integration, and patient experience.

      2. Maintains awareness of referral procedures, Contract Health Services, and community mental health resources.

      3. Attending required meetings and training.

      4. Comply with all MCNDOH policies, procedures, and professional standards.

      5. Maintains regular and reliable attendance.

      6. Performs other duties as assigned.
